I was able to take a look at the talon today to see why it wasn't charging. I was not looking forward to dealing with charging issues. Luckily it's just the alternator relocation bracket broke. So it's an easy fix. I was able to get a hold of jay from Jay racing and he said he can ship a new one out tomorrow. It was either another aluminum one free of charge or an upgraded steel one for $25. I went with the steel one to hopefully avoid this issue in the future.

Well I got the new alt bracket yesterday. Being steel It is definitely a lot heavier or a lot more stout. Hopefully I won't have any problems with this one for a long time. I put the car back together tonight. I just need to charge the battery and fire her up.
I'm waiting on a vband and clamp clamp for my exhaust. Hopefully it will be here early next week. As of right now it's setup to swap turbos and have the exhaust done next Saturday. Well finished up the car tonight. Charged up the battery and fired her up. Still wasn't charging. The alt fuse blew. Put a new fuse in and she's good to go charging at 14.3v :-).
Also got the stuff for the turbo swap and my exhaust today. I had to track it down at the brewing supply company next door cause FedEx doesn't know how to deliver to the right place. The turbo swap and exhaust will be done this Saturday. I'm excited to finally get the 6766 on the car!
